## Configuration

The Verdana greenhouse controller recalibrates humidity and CO2 sensors nightly to correct drift. Drift coefficients live in `drift.toml`; do not edit by hand. If drift exceeds 5% between cycles, the controller flags the sensor and pulls a reference curve from the Hollyvale calibration service. That fetch is authenticated. Calibration runs at 02:00 local; stagger it if you add zones. Set the calibration service credential in the env file with this line:

secret setting of yajog-taguf: ARCHIVE_KEY3=051

Handover: Profile Store Sharding (Quillhaven team)

To whoever takes this over from me: the user-profile store is half-migrated to the new shard ring. Shards 0–5 are live; 6–11 still read from the old Bramblewick cluster. Do not rebalance until the backfill job finishes. The migration console requires elevated access; to unlock it, enter the recovery passphrase, which is:

vault phrase of kafog-kahif = holdor-rusir-praox

Test-plan note — Monthly partitioning (Ledgerloom DB)

Quick heads-up before you start: we partition `events` by calendar month, so your tests need rows spanning at least three months to hit the pruning logic. Seed January–March via the fixtures script, then verify queries only scan the expected partition. The rollover job runs nightly; trigger it manually in staging. The staging API accepts the bearer token below.

portal login ticket: eyJhbGciOiJIUzI1NiIsInR5cCI6IkpXVCJ9.eyJzdWIiOiIMjvRAf3PEFIn0.nuv9gjixLtnr

## LargeDiff runbook — restart procedure

The Cobblewick diff viewer (service name: largediff-web) renders diffs for files up to 2 GB by streaming chunks from the Marrow blob store. If renders hang, first check the chunker pods; they fail quietly when the temp volume fills. Restart order matters: chunker first, then the render workers, then the web tier. Do not restart the blob cache — it rebuilds slowly and will cause timeouts for an hour. The service reads its settings at startup from the values shown below.

settings of tahag-tahag:
[istdor]
host = istdor.tolvaqcorp.corp
user = istdor_svc
database = istdor_prod